引入了实Hilbert空间中一类新的一般多值混合隐拟变分不等式.它概括了丁协平教授引入与研究过的熟知的广义混合隐拟变分不等式类成特例.运用辅助变分原理技巧来解这类一般多值混合隐拟变分不等式.首先,定义了具真凸下半连续的二元泛函的新的辅助变分不等式,并选取了一适当的泛函,使得其唯一的最小值点等价于此辅助变分不等式的解.其次,利用此辅助变分不等式,构造了用于计算一般多值混合隐拟变分不等式逼近解的新的迭代算法.在此,等价性保证了算法能够生成一列逼近解.最后,证明了一般多值混合隐拟变分不等式解的存在性与逼近解的收敛性.而且,给算法提供了新的收敛判据.因此,结果对M.A.Noor提出的公开问题给出了一个肯定答案,并推广和改进了关于各种变分不等式与补问题的早期与最近的结果,包括最近文献中涉及单值与集值映象的有关混合变分不等式、混合拟变不等式与拟补问题的相应结果.  相似文献

在自反Banach空间内,引入和研究了一类新的涉及广义混合似变分不等式问题的双水平广义混合平衡问题(BGMEP).首先,为了计算BGMEP的近似解,引入了一类辅助广义混合平衡问题(AGMEP).由使用一极小极大不等式,在没有任何强制条件的相当温和假设下,证明了AGMEP解的存在性和唯一性.利用辅助原理技巧,建议和分析了一类计算BGMEP的近似解的新迭代算法.在没有任何强制条件的相当温和假设下,证明了由算法生成的迭代序列的强收敛性.这些结果是新的并且推广了这一领域内某些最近结果.  相似文献

In this paper, we introduce and study a new system of generalized set-valued strongly nonlinear mixed variational-like inequalities problems and its related auxiliary problems in reflexive Banach spaces. The auxiliary principle technique is applied to study the existence and iterative algorithm of solutions for the system of generalized set-valued strongly nonlinear mixed variational-like inequalities problems. Firstly, we prove the existence and uniqueness of solutions of the auxiliary problems for the system of generalized set-valued strongly nonlinear mixed variational-like inequalities problems. Secondly, an iterative algorithm for solving the system of generalized set-valued strongly nonlinear mixed variational-like inequalities problems is constructed by using this existence and uniqueness result. Finally, we show the existence of solutions of the system of generalized set-valued strongly nonlinear mixed variational-like inequalities problems and discuss the convergence analysis of this algorithm. These results improve, unify and generalize many corresponding known results given in literatures.  相似文献

The purpose of this paper is to investigate the iterative algorithm for finding approximate solutionsof a class of mixed variational-like inequalities in a real Hilbert space,where the iterative algorithm is presentedby virtue of the auxiliary principle technique.On one hand,the existence of approximate solutions of this classof mixed variational-like inequalities is proven.On the other hand,it is shown that the approximate solutionsconverge strongly to the exact solution of this class of mixed variational-like inequalities.  相似文献

In this paper, we study the class of mixed variational-like inequalities in reflexive Banach spaces. By applying a minimax inequality due to the author, some existence and uniqueness theorems for solutions of mixed variational-like inequalities are proved. Next, by applying the auxiliary problem technique, we suggest an innovative iterative algorithm to compute approximate solutions of the mixed variational-like inequality. Finally, convergence criteria are also discussed. This research was supported by NSF, Sichman Education Department of China, Projects 2003A081 and SZD0406.
